Questões de Concurso Público TCE-RO 2013 para Analista de Informática
Foram encontradas 16 questões
O padrão Indirection é utilizado para atribuir responsabilidades à classe que tiver a informação necessária para satisfazer a responsabilidade
O padrão Don’t Talk to Strangers é utilizado para fortalecer o polimorfismo, realizado pelo padrão Polymorphism. O objetivo de ambos os padrões é substituir um componente sem afetar outro componente, embora o primeiro implemente o polimorfismo em nível de classe e o segundo lide com alternativas embasadas no tipo de componente.
Uma das aplicabilidades do padrão Iterator é a representação de hierarquias do tipo todo-parte de objetos, de modo que a aplicação seja capaz de ignorar a diferença entre composições de objetos e objetos individuais, haja vista que todos os objetos tratados no padrão têm comportamento uniforme.
O padrão Adapter será mais apropriado que o Façade quando for necessário fornecer uma interface unificada para um conjunto de interfaces em um subsistema.
O uso do padrão Builder tem a vantagem de permitir acesso controlado à instância de uma classe, uma vez que ele encapsula a classe, criando um ponto global único de acesso.